Venue and Seating Information
The Echo is a small, intimate live music venue located at 1822 W Sunset Blvd, Los Angeles, CA 90026, with a capacity of approximately 350 attendees. The venue is primarily designed for standing-room general admission shows, creating an immersive atmosphere for concert-goers. Fans have praised the venue for its excellent acoustics and close proximity to the stage, making it an ideal spot for experiencing live music.
Reviews indicate that the best sections for viewing are the front-center positions near the stage, where fans can enjoy an up-close experience with their favorite artists. However, some attendees have noted that the back corners near entrances can obstruct sightlines during crowded shows, making these areas less desirable. Overall, the venue's layout fosters a vibrant energy that enhances the live performance experience.
Parking Information
Parking around The Echo can be challenging due to its location in Echo Park. The venue does not offer on-site parking; therefore, visitors typically rely on street parking or nearby public lots. Street parking is available around Sunset Blvd and Glendale Blvd but can be competitive during events.
- Lemoyne Street Paid Lot – Near 1152 Lemoyne St, Los Angeles, CA 90026; moderate pricing; high demand.
- Lot 679 (Sunset Blvd area) – 1707 W Sunset Blvd, Los Angeles, CA 90026; low to moderate pricing; short walk to venue.
- Private Garages / Driveways – Moderate to higher prices; often reserved in advance through apps.
- Rideshare Services (Uber/Lyft) – Recommended due to traffic congestion; drop-off near Sunset Blvd entrance.
It is advisable for attendees to arrive early or consider rideshare options to avoid post-event traffic congestion. Fans often try to avoid street parking in permit-only residential zones due to strict enforcement and potential towing risks.
